
20 Oct
Posted by: From the editors I Don't Know How But They Found Me, Reviews
The discovery of a new universe... IDKHOW new album "Razzmatazz"
If you've always wished for an encounter with the third way or are in the mood for new, unusual music, then you've come to the right place, because today we want to...